python plot函数参数
时间: 2023-06-22 14:42:36 浏览: 112
Python中的plot函数通常用于绘制数据的图形。它可以接受以下参数:
- x:x轴上的数据点
- y:y轴上的数据点
- linestyle:线条样式
- linewidth:线宽
- marker:数据点的标记样式
- markersize:标记的大小
- markeredgecolor:标记的边缘颜色
- markerfacecolor:标记的填充颜色
- label:图例标签
- color:线条颜色
除此之外,plot函数还可以通过传递一个字典参数来设置这些参数的值。例如:
```python
import matplotlib.pyplot as plt
# 定义数据
x = [1, 2, 3, 4, 5]
y = [1, 4, 9, 16, 25]
# 绘制图形
plt.plot(x, y, {'linestyle': '-', 'linewidth': 2, 'marker': 'o', 'markersize': 8, 'markeredgecolor': 'black', 'markerfacecolor': 'red', 'label': 'data', 'color': 'blue'})
# 添加图例
plt.legend()
# 显示图形
plt.show()
```
这个例子中,我们使用了一个字典参数来设置plot函数的参数值。
相关问题
python plot函数
在Python中,`matplotlib`是一个常用的绘图库,可以用它来创建各种类型的图表,包括线图、散点图、柱状图等。其中,`plot`函数用于绘制线图,以下是一个简单的例子:
```python
import matplotlib.pyplot as plt
import numpy as np
# 生成数据
x = np.linspace(0, 10, 100)
y = np.sin(x)
# 绘制线图
plt.plot(x, y)
# 添加标题和坐标轴标签
plt.title('Sine Function')
plt.xlabel('X Axis')
plt.ylabel('Y Axis')
# 显示图形
plt.show()
```
上述代码首先导入了`matplotlib`库和`numpy`库,然后使用`linspace`函数生成一个包含100个元素的数组`x`,再使用`sin`函数生成对应的函数值数组`y`。接下来,调用`plot`函数绘制线图,将`x`数组作为横坐标,`y`数组作为纵坐标。最后,使用`title`函数、`xlabel`函数和`ylabel`函数添加标题和坐标轴标签,并使用`show`函数显示图形。
除了上述基本用法,`plot`函数还有很多参数可以调整,例如线型、颜色、标记等。可以参考官方文档或其他教程进行学习和使用。
python的plot函数参数
Python的plot函数是Matplotlib库中的一个函数,用于绘制2D图形。下面是plot函数的常用参数:
- x:横坐标数据
- y:纵坐标数据
- label:数据标签
- color:线条颜色
- linewidth:线条宽度
- linestyle:线条样式
- marker:标记点样式
- markersize:标记点大小
- alpha:透明度
- xlabel:横坐标标签
- ylabel:纵坐标标签
- title:图形标题
- xlim:横坐标范围
- ylim:纵坐标范围
- legend:是否显示图例
- grid:是否显示网格线
这些参数可以根据具体需求进行选择和设置。
阅读全文